Inhaltsangabe:
This book is a helpful list of annotations that have been boiled down the essence of each book, chapter, or journal article, with the author’s viewpoint and input.
The articles and chapter annotations required for graded submission were created and compiled in this book for future academics and learners to enrich their understanding of Education and Training and Development in the Human Resources and Government Contracting arenas. Those academics seeking quick annotations and notes on those academic writings can gain insight to the discipline from this book.
Between 2009 and 2012 the author completed coursework for a Doctorate of Philosophy in Occupational and Technical Studies (STEMPS), with a concentration on Training and Development in Human Resources.
All Ph.D. coursework and research was conducted and completed at Old Dominion University, Norfolk, VA. Many of the mandatory program courses required annotations of literature reviews.
The annotations completed were concentrated on the field and industry in which the author was dedicated to in completing the required literature review for the final dissertation.
Those fields and industries were the Human Resources career field and the industry of Government Contracting.
The courses in which the annotations were required research and writing were:
SEPS-885: CurriculumDevelopment OTED-850: Issues in Training, Modeling & Simulation OTED-861: Adult Foundations of Learning OTED-862: Administration & Management of Career & Technical Education &Training Programs
Über die Autorin bzw. den Autor:
Dawn D. Boyer, Ph.D. completed her Doctor of Philosophy in Education (Occupational & Technical Studies, with a concentration in Training & Development in Human Resources) from Old Dominion University in Norfolk, VA in 2013. Her dissertation is entitled, ‘Competencies of Human Resources Practitioners within the Government Contracting Industry,’ which identified unique KSAs for Human Resources Managers working for federal level government contracting companies. This groundbreaking research is the impetus upon her textbook guide for Human Resources Professionals in Government Contracting, currently in the works.
She has been an entrepreneur and business owner for 14+ years, currently in her consulting firm, D. Boyer Consulting, based in Richmond (Henrico County), VA, and servicing clients internationally. Her background experience is 24+ years in the Human Resources field, of which 11 years are within the federal defense contracting industry.
Dr. Boyer’s experience in federal (defense) contracting as a Human Resources Director or Senior Manager has provided her insight, experience, practice, and capabilities to perform within this industry, as well as instruct others to abilities needed in middle-management or executive human resource roles.
